The 2006 list of scams contains most for this traditional remarks. There are, however, three new areas being targeted by the irs. They and a few other people are highlighted in the following list.
Identity Theft/Phishing. This isn't so much a tax reduction scam as a nightmare wherein identity thieves try to obtain information from taxpayers by acting as IRS agents. Often they send out email as though they come from the Irs. The IRS never sends emails to taxpayers, so don't respond to the telltale emails. If you aren't sure, call the IRS and ask them if you have a problem. It is possible to transfer pricing reach the government at 800-829-1040.
